Manual Change Information
At Branson, we strive to maintain our position as the leader in ultrasonics plastics joining, cleaning and
related technologies by continually improving our circuits and components in our equipment. These
improvements are incorporated as soon as they are developed and thoroughly tested.
Information concerning any improvements will be added to the appropriate technical documentation at its
next revision and printing. Therefore, when requesting service assistance for specific units, note the Revi-
sion information found on the cover of this document, and refer to the printing date which appears at the
bottom of this page.
